Parent-Child Interaction Therapy (PCIT): What to Expect in a Session

PCIT is a research-backed therapy designed to improve parent-child relationships and reduce problem behaviors. It focuses on coaching parents in real-time on how to interact with their child in a way that fosters positive behaviors and emotional regulation.
